Security forces on Thursday gunned down two terrorists in an overnight encounter which broke out on Wednesday Evening in North Kashmir's Sopore.

A senior police official told MyNation that an encounter broke out after terrorists in hiding fired upon security forces during a door-to-door search operation last evening.

"Two terrorists have been killed so far in this encounter and the operation is still underway," he added.

The identity of the deceased terrorists are yet to be ascertained but sources suggest that both of them are locals.

The operation was initiated by a joint team of the Indian Army's RR, the CRPF and the Special Operations Group of Jammu and Kashmir Police after receiving information about the presence of two or three terrorists in the area.

Following clashes, authorities have imposed section 144 of the CrPC in the area and internet services have been barred as a precautionary measure.
